How much do associate transport planner jobs pay per year?

As of May 29, 2026, the average yearly pay for associate transport planner in the United States is $78,283.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$64,000.00 and $91,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Associate Transport Planner vs Transport Planner?

AspectAssociate Transport PlannerTransport Planner
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in transportation, urban planning, or related field; often entry-level certificationsBachelor's degree; may have additional certifications or experience
Work EnvironmentSupportive team setting, assisting senior planners on projectsLead planning projects, coordinate with clients and stakeholders
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in consulting firms, government agencies, and transportation companiesMore senior roles within similar organizations

The main difference is that an Associate Transport Planner typically supports and assists in planning tasks, often as an entry-level role, while a Transport Planner takes on more responsibility, leads projects, and makes strategic decisions. Both roles require similar educational backgrounds, but the Transport Planner usually has more experience and autonomy.

Under direction of the Senior Transportation Planner, a Branch Chief, within the Office to the Strategic Freight Planning the Associate Transportation Planner leads in the development and updating of the State Freight Plan, implementation of the California Sustainable Freight Action Plan, the coordination of the freight outreach activities, and other actions supporting the Department's freight planning responsibilities. The incumbent serves as a liaison to assigned Caltrans District(s) and partner agencies within those Districts, an assigned freight mode, and/or focused topic area(s).
